Alternative Ingredients
- Pizza dough: Use whole wheat, gluten-free, or homemade dough if preferred.
- Dairy-free mozzarella: Swap with regular mozzarella if you do not need dairy-free.
- Turkey bacon: Use regular bacon, chicken bacon, or plant-based bacon for your Chicken Bacon Ranch Calzone.
- Fresh dill: Use dried dill if fresh is not available.
- Baby spinach: Substitute with chopped kale, arugula, or omit it.
- Dairy-free milk: Use any unsweetened plain milk you have on hand.

Expert Tips
Seal them well: Press the edges firmly before crimping so the filling stays inside.
Do not overfill: A little extra filling feels tempting, but it can cause leaks while baking.
Keep the dough soft: Let refrigerated dough sit at room temperature so it rolls out easier.
Add ranch lightly: Too much sauce inside can make the calzones soggy.
Let them rest: Cooling for a few minutes helps the filling set before slicing.
Use parchment paper: It keeps the bottoms from sticking and makes cleanup easier.

Chicken Bacon Ranch Calzone
Equipment
Ingredients
For the ranch
- 1/3 cup mayonnaise dairy-free or regular
- 2 tbsp milk unsweetened plain dairy-free or regular
- 1 tbsp fresh lemon juice
- 1 tbsp fresh dill chopped (1 teaspoon dried dill)
- 1 tbsp fresh parsley chopped
- 1/2 tsp garlic powder
- 1/2 tsp onion powder
- 1/4 tsp sea salt
- 1/8 tsp black pepper
For the calzones
- 1 lb pizza dough store-bought or homemade
- 1 1/2 cups cooked chicken shredded or chopped
- 4 slices turkey bacon cooked and chopped
- 1 cup mozzarella-style cheese dairy free or regular, shredded
- 1 cup baby spinach roughly chopped
- 1/4 cup red onion thinly sliced
- 1 tbsp avocado oil
- 1/2 tsp garlic powder
- 1/2 tsp dried oregano
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 1/4 tsp sea salt
- 2-3 tbsp ranch for filling
- 1 tbsp avocado oil for brushing the tops
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 425°F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Make the ranch. In a small bowl, whisk together the mayo, milk, lemon juice, dill, parsley,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and black pepper until smooth.1/3 cup mayonnaise, 2 tbsp milk, 1 tbsp fresh lemon juice, 1 tbsp fresh dill, 1 tbsp fresh parsley, 1/2 tsp garlic powder, 1/2 tsp onion powder, 1/4 tsp sea salt, 1/8 tsp black pepper
- In a medium bowl, combine the chicken, chopped turkey bacon, cheese, spinach, red onion, 1 tablespoon avocado oil, garlic powder, oregano, black pepper, salt, and 2 to 3 tablespoons of the ranch. Toss until evenly mixed.1 1/2 cups cooked chicken, 4 slices turkey bacon, 1 cup mozzarella-style cheese, 1 cup baby spinach, 1/4 cup red onion, 1 tbsp avocado oil, 1/2 tsp garlic powder, 1/2 tsp dried oregano, 1/4 tsp black pepper, 1/4 tsp sea salt, 2-3 tbsp ranch
- Divide the pizza dough into 4 equal pieces. On a lightly floured surface, roll each piece into a circle about 6 to 7 inches wide.1 lb pizza dough
- Spoon the filling onto one half of each dough circle, leaving a border around the edges. Fold the other half over the filling and press the edges together. Crimp with a fork or pinch tightly to seal.
- Transfer the calzones to the baking sheet. Cut a small slit in the top of each one so steam can escape. Brush the tops lightly with avocado oil.1 tbsp avocado oil
- Bake for 20 to 24 minutes, or until the calzones are golden and cooked through.
- Let them cool for 5 to 10 minutes before serving. Serve with the extra ranch on the side.
